John Salveson is a successful entrepreneur, business leader and board director with expert knowledge of human capital management, leadership transition and succession, business strategy, and governance. John has more than 30 years of experience in professional services, assisting a broad range of clients from diverse industry sectors. He serves as a trusted advisor to business owners, senior executives, investors, and board directors, helping them create shareholder and stakeholder value through the effective combination of business and organizational strategy and talent.

John is Co-Founder and Principal of Salveson Stetson Group, Inc. (SSG), a firm dedicated to helping organizations attract and retain talent. SSG is a multi-specialty practice, focused on retained executive search in human resources, sales and marketing, finance, and general management. From its start in mid-1996, SSG has sustained rapid growth and is currently ranked 19th on Forbes’ annual list of America’s Best Executive Recruiting Firms. SSG is a member of IIC Partners, one of the top ten retained executive search groups in the world with 53 offices in 35 countries. SSG’s clients range from Fortune 50 companies to private small and mid-sized firms. Since its founding, SSG has performed successful executive search assignments for more than 150 companies in the United States and Europe. Industry specializations include pharmaceuticals, wholesale distribution, distributed services, healthcare, non-profit, manufacturing, and business/professional services. Search assignments include Board Directors, President/CEO, COO, CFO, CMO, CIO and other senior level executive positions. John is also President of Salveson Leadership Advisors, LLC. In this role, he works with non-profit CEOs and their boards on issues related to strategy, governance, and organization effectiveness.

Through his leadership roles with several large non-profit organizations, John has recruited and developed executives and board members and served as a subject matter expert on human resources, talent management, governance, succession planning, executive coaching, and organization development. During his ten years as a Board Member, Vice Chairman and Member of the Executive Committee for The Philadelphia Orchestra, he played a critical role in the search for two CEOs, the transition to a new Board Chair, and helped manage a host of issues related to the Orchestra’s transition into and out of bankruptcy. Currently, John serves as Chairman for two major Philadelphia Region non-profit organizations. WHYY is the region’s largest public broadcaster, with a national reputation for innovation and excellence. United Way of Greater Philadelphia and Southern New Jersey is a nearly 100-year-old institution dedicated to ending intergenerational poverty. John recently served as the Chair of the Governance Review Task Force for United Way, helping to reinvent and rejuvenate this indispensable organization. In the for-profit sector, John serves as a Director at Bellrock Intelligence, an early stage company focused on the social determinants of health.

John is also the Founder and President of the Foundation to Abolish Child Sex Abuse, Inc. (FACSA). He has been a frequent public speaker on the issue of child sexual abuse and has received international print, radio, and television coverage in his role as an advocate.

John holds both Master of Arts and Bachelor of Arts degrees from the University of Notre Dame. He received the 2015 Eleanor H. Raynolds Award, given annually to an executive search professional who combines excellence in search with a strong commitment to volunteerism.
